#ABDEED Color
#ABDEED is rgb(171, 222, 237) in RGB, hsl(194, 65%, 80%) in HSL, and about cmyk(28%, 6%, 0%, 7%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Non-photo Blue (#A4DDED),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 2.05.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#ABDEED Channel Values
How #ABDEED bre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 171 · G 222 · B 237 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 194° · S 65% · L 80%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 194° · S 28% · V 93%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 28% · M 6% · Y 0% · K 7%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.46:1 vs white · 14.4: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#ABDEED background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#ABDEED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#ABDEED?
#ABDEED is a lightest teal — rgb(171, 222, 237) in RGB and hsl(194, 65%, 80%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Non-photo Blue (#A4DDED),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 2.05.
What is the RGB value of #ABDEED?
#ABDEED is rgb(171, 222, 237) — red 171, green 222, and blue 237 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#ABDEED?
#ABDEED converts to approximately cmyk(28%, 6%, 0%, 7%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#ABDEED be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#ABDEED scores 1.46:1 against white and 14.4: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#ABDEED as a CSS color keyword?
No. #ABDEED is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ightblue (#ADD8E6) at a CIE76 distance of 3.06, which is very hard to tell apart.
